At Long Eaton Station, ticket purchase and collection is a breeze with both a ticket office and reliable ticket machines on hand. The ticket office operates Monday to Saturday from 06:05 to 17:30, and on Sundays from 08:45 to 16:05. If you've bought your tickets online, simply collect them conveniently at the ticket machine.
For those with accessibility needs, the station is categorized as fully accessible with step-free access across all platforms and tactile paving to assist visually-impaired passengers. The sheltered waiting areas are equipped with accessible seating, making your wait for the train both comfortable and accommodating. However, it is important to note that there are no toilets or refreshment facilities available on-site.
Transitioning to other transport modes is seamless at Long Eaton. There are taxis available that can be booked via Central at 0115 973 4788 or Market at 0115 849 8081. For bus services and making further travel arrangements, you can find detailed guidance for your onward journey in the printable formats available online. The rail replacement services, crucial in times of rail disruptions, are accessible right from the station's car park.

Headingley Station is equipped with all the essential amenities catering to a variety of travelers. While there isn't a traditional ticket office, rest assured that 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ting tickets bought online. They are accessible for all, ensuring ease of use. For those embracing the digital age, smartcards can be both issued and validated here. Although staff assistance isn't available at the station, there's always help just a call away. CCTV cameras provide security, while departure screens and announcements keep you informed.
If accessibility is a concern, you'll be pleased to know that Headingley Station is a Category A station, with step-free access throughout. Lifts and subways facilitate easy movement across the platforms. However, amenities such as toilets, waiting rooms, and refreshment options are not present, so it's best to plan accordingly. With a modest car park offering some free spaces, you won't have to worry about parking charges while you catch your train.
Once you've arrived at Headingley, a host of onward travel options are available to help you reach your final destination. Bus services can be accessed conveniently with a stop located close to the station, and for detailed information, Busline can be reached at 0871 200 2233. If you're opting for taxis, you can pre-book through their Cab4you service. Cyclists will be glad to know that while bicycle hire isn't available at the station, there is limited bicycle storage within the car park.
